The Biological Function of Leaves
Leaves are the primary sites of photosynthesis, the process by which plants convert sunlight into chemical energy. This process is vital not only for the plant’s survival but also for life on Earth as a whole.
- Photosynthesis: Leaves contain chlorophyll, a green pigment that captures sunlight. This energy is used to convert carbon dioxide and water into glucose and oxygen, providing food for the plant and releasing oxygen into the atmosphere.
- Transpiration: Leaves also play a role in transpiration, the process of water movement through a plant and its evaporation from aerial parts. This helps in nutrient uptake and temperature regulation.
- Gas Exchange: Through tiny openings called stomata, leaves facilitate the exchange of gases, allowing carbon dioxide to enter for photosynthesis and oxygen to exit as a byproduct.
Ecological Importance of Leaves
Leaves are integral to the health of ecosystems. They provide food, habitat, and contribute to the nutrient cycle.
- Food Source: Leaves are a primary food source for a wide range of organisms, from insects to herbivores. For example, caterpillars feed on leaves, which in turn become food for birds.
- Habitat: Leaves offer shelter and breeding grounds for various species. The leaf litter on the forest floor is home to countless microorganisms and insects.
- Nutrient Cycling: When leaves fall and decompose, they enrich the soil with nutrients, supporting plant growth and maintaining soil health.
Cultural and Economic Impact of Leaves
Beyond their ecological roles, leaves have significant cultural and economic value. They have been used in traditional medicine, art, and industry.
- Traditional Medicine: Many cultures have used leaves for their medicinal properties. For instance, the leaves of the neem tree are known for their antibacterial and antifungal properties.
- Art and Symbolism: Leaves have been a symbol of growth and renewal in various cultures. They are often depicted in art and literature as symbols of life and prosperity.
- Economic Uses: Leaves are used in various industries. The tea industry, for example, relies heavily on the leaves of the Camellia sinensis plant. Additionally, leaves like those of the banana plant are used as eco-friendly packaging materials.
